다운코드 편집자는 x86과 x64 아키텍처의 차이점에 대한 심층적인 이해를 제공합니다! 이 기사에서는 기술적 배경, 성능 비교, 호환성, 운영 체제 지원, 향후 동향 및 사용자 선택 등 6가지 측면에서 x86과 x64 아키텍처 간의 유사점과 차이점을 종합적으로 분석하여 이 두 아키텍처의 적용 가능한 시나리오를 더 잘 이해할 수 있도록 돕습니다. 더 현명한 선택. 개발자와 일반 사용자 모두 이 기사를 통해 많은 이점을 얻을 수 있으며 x86 및 x64 아키텍처에 대해 더 깊이 이해할 수 있습니다.
x86 아키텍처는 1978년 Intel 8086 프로세서에서 시작되었습니다. 시간이 지남에 따라 이 아키텍처는 많은 업데이트와 확장을 거쳐 32비트 컴퓨팅의 표준이 되었습니다. x64 아키텍처는 AMD에서 처음 출시되었으며 나중에 Intel에서 지원됩니다. x86을 기반으로 64비트 처리에 대한 지원이 추가되었습니다.
x64 아키텍처는 x86보다 높은 처리 성능을 제공합니다. 이는 주로 x64 프로세서가 더 많은 레지스터와 더 넓은 데이터 경로를 갖고 있어 더 많은 양의 데이터를 처리할 수 있기 때문입니다. 또한 64비트 시스템은 4GB 이상의 메모리를 지원할 수 있는데, 이는 메모리 집약적인 애플리케이션을 실행하는 데 매우 중요합니다.
x64 아키텍처는 x86과 역호환되지만 실제 사용에는 여전히 일부 호환성 문제가 있습니다. 일부 오래된 32비트 애플리케이션은 64비트 운영 체제, 특히 특정 하드웨어 드라이버에 의존하는 운영 체제에서 실행되지 않거나 성능이 저하될 수 있습니다.
대부분의 최신 운영 체제와 소프트웨어는 x64 아키텍처를 지원합니다. 하지만 특정 분야의 일부 오래된 소프트웨어나 애플리케이션의 경우 여전히 x86만 지원하는 경우가 있습니다. 소프트웨어 개발자는 애플리케이션이 서로 다른 시스템에서 실행될 수 있도록 두 아키텍처 간의 차이점을 고려해야 합니다.
지속적인 기술 개발로 x64 아키텍처가 점차 주류로 자리잡고 있습니다. 더 많은 소프트웨어와 운영 체제가 32비트 프로세서에 대한 지원을 중단하고 64비트 컴퓨팅에 초점을 맞추기 시작했습니다. 이러한 추세는 x86 아키텍처가 점차 시장에서 사라지고 x64가 미래의 표준이 될 것임을 나타냅니다.
사용자는 컴퓨터와 소프트웨어를 선택할 때 두 아키텍처의 차이점을 고려해야 합니다. 고성능과 대용량 메모리 지원이 필요한 애플리케이션의 경우 x64가 더 나은 선택입니다. 그러나 기본적인 애플리케이션만 실행해야 하는 사람들에게는 x86이 여전히 실행 가능한 옵션입니다.
결론: x86 및 x64 아키텍처는 각각 고유한 특성과 적용 가능한 시나리오를 가지고 있습니다. 기술이 발전함에 따라 x64가 주류가 되었지만 일부 영역에서는 x86이 여전히 그 중요성을 유지하고 있습니다. 사용자와 개발자 모두 자신의 요구 사항에 가장 적합한 선택을 하려면 두 아키텍처 간의 차이점을 이해해야 합니다.
FAQ:
Q: x86과 x64 아키텍처의 주요 차이점은 무엇입니까? 답변: x86 아키텍처는 32비트 처리 기술을 기반으로 하며 주로 초기 개인용 컴퓨터 및 서버에 사용되는 반면, x64 아키텍처는 x86의 64비트 확장으로 더 높은 처리 성능과 더 큰 메모리 지원을 제공합니다. x64는 더 많은 데이터를 처리할 수 있고 4GB 이상의 메모리를 지원하는 반면 x86은 최대 4GB 메모리로 제한됩니다. Q: x64 아키텍처가 더 높은 처리 성능을 제공하는 이유는 무엇입니까? 답변: x64 아키텍처는 더 많은 레지스터와 더 넓은 데이터 경로를 갖고 있기 때문에 더 높은 처리 성능을 제공합니다. 이를 통해 x64 프로세서는 더 많은 데이터를 동시에 처리할 수 있어 전반적인 컴퓨팅 효율성이 향상됩니다. 또한 64비트 시스템이 지원하는 대용량 메모리는 메모리 집약적인 애플리케이션을 실행할 때 더 나은 성능을 제공합니다. Q: 항상 x64 기반 컴퓨터를 선택해야 합니까? A: 귀하의 사용 요구 사항에 따라 다릅니다. 작업이나 애플리케이션에 고급 그래픽 처리, 게임 또는 데이터 분석과 같은 대용량 메모리나 고성능 컴퓨팅이 필요한 경우 x64 아키텍처가 더 나은 선택이 될 것입니다. 그러나 웹 탐색 및 문서 편집과 같은 일부 기본 응용 프로그램의 경우 x86 기반 컴퓨터가 여전히 요구 사항을 충족할 수 있습니다. Q: 32비트 소프트웨어를 64비트 시스템에서 실행할 수 있습니까? A: 대부분의 32비트 소프트웨어는 64비트 시스템에서 실행될 수 있지만 성능이 최적이 아닐 수 있습니다. 그러나 특수 하드웨어 드라이버를 사용하는 특정 32비트 응용 프로그램은 64비트 시스템에서 제대로 실행되지 않을 수 있습니다. 따라서 특정 이전 소프트웨어를 사용하는 경우 이러한 호환성 문제를 고려할 수 있습니다.Downcodes 편집자의 이 분석이 x86 및 x64 아키텍처를 더 잘 이해하는 데 도움이 되기를 바랍니다! 질문이 있으시면 댓글란에 메시지를 남겨주세요.